What affects the price

The final price for impact windows depends on several variables. The biggest factor is the size and type of your window frames, along with the specific glass thickness required for your local building codes. Opting for custom shapes or specialized tints also shifts the total. Installation complexity matters too; if your existing frames are damaged or if the project requires extra structural support, labor costs will increase.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

Summer heat puts a massive strain on air conditioning systems. Impact windows help manage indoor temperatures by blocking out intense solar heat, which means your cooling system does not have to work nearly as hard. This efficiency is a huge benefit during the hottest months, helping you maintain a cool home without excessive energy waste.

What is an impact window?

An impact window is designed to withstand strong winds and projectile impacts, commonly from storms. They feature laminated glass that holds together even when broken, preventing shards from scattering. This offers superior protection compared to standard windows.

What are the drawbacks of impact windows?

While beneficial, impact windows can sometimes have a slightly darker tint or a subtle distortion compared to regular glass, though modern options minimize this. Installation can also be more involved. We can discuss these points with you when you call.
